If an error occurred during initialisation, we would sometimes fail to
call scsi_host_put() and thus end up with a leaked scsi_host.  It was
also possible to miss calling scsi_remove_host().

 drivers/scsi/aic94xx/aic94xx_init.c |   17 +++++++++--------
 1 files changed, 9 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/scsi/aic94xx/aic94xx_init.c 
b/drivers/scsi/aic94xx/aic94xx_init.c
index 63bcde2..12738bc 100644
--- a/drivers/scsi/aic94xx/aic94xx_init.c
+++ b/drivers/scsi/aic94xx/aic94xx_init.c
@@ -583,7 +583,7 @@ static int __devinit asd_pci_probe(struct pci_dev *dev,
        asd_ha = kzalloc(sizeof(*asd_ha), GFP_KERNEL);
        if (!asd_ha) {
                asd_printk("out of memory\n");
-               goto Err;
+               goto Err_put;
        }
        asd_ha->pcidev = dev;
        asd_ha->sas_ha.dev = &asd_ha->pcidev->dev;
@@ -600,14 +600,12 @@ static int __devinit asd_pci_probe(struct pci_dev *dev,
        shost->max_cmd_len = 16;
 
        err = scsi_add_host(shost, &dev->dev);
-       if (err) {
-               scsi_host_put(shost);
+       if (err)
                goto Err_free;
-       }
 
        err = asd_dev->setup(asd_ha);
        if (err)
-               goto Err_free;
+               goto Err_remove;
 
        err = -ENODEV;
        if (!pci_set_dma_mask(dev, DMA_64BIT_MASK)
@@ -618,14 +616,14 @@ static int __devinit asd_pci_probe(struct pci_dev *dev,
                ;
        else {
                asd_printk("no suitable DMA mask for %s\n", pci_name(dev));
-               goto Err_free;
+               goto Err_remove;
        }
 
        pci_set_drvdata(dev, asd_ha);
 
        err = asd_map_ha(asd_ha);
        if (err)
-               goto Err_free;
+               goto Err_remove;
 
        err = asd_create_ha_caches(asd_ha);
         if (err)
@@ -692,9 +690,12 @@ Err_free_cache:
        asd_destroy_ha_caches(asd_ha);
 Err_unmap:
        asd_unmap_ha(asd_ha);
+Err_remove:
+       scsi_remove_host(shost);
 Err_free:
        kfree(asd_ha);
-       scsi_remove_host(shost);
+Err_put:
+       scsi_host_put(shost);
 Err:
        pci_disable_device(dev);
        return err;
